Porsche considering F1 return?

NEWS STORY
01/10/2010

Porsche chairman Matthias Mueller has revealed that his company is considering returning to F1, possibly in 2013 when the new engine regulations are due to be released.

Although it ended its highly successful works sportscar programme in 1998, it has since produced customer cars. On the other hand, 'sister' manufacturer Audi, which has long been linked with a return to F1, is still prominent in sportscar racing.

"With LMP1, there are two classes and two brands - Audi and Porsche," Mueller told Autocar at the Paris Motor Show. "We do not like to both go into LMP1, that is not so funny.

"So therefore we have to discuss whether it makes better sense for one of the brands to go into LMP1, and the other brand into F1. So we will have a round-table to discuss the pros and cons."

The Stuttgart manufacturer, which along with Audi, Bentley, Bugatti, Lamborghini and SEAT forms part of the Volkswagen Group, is legendary in motorsport having won - and dominated in almost all disciplines. However, in terms of F1, other than its involvement in the highly successful TAG turbo engine project with McLaren, as a constructor it only contested two season (1961 and 1962) though it had previously taken part in world championship Grands Prix, albeit to F2 regulations.

Should the Stuttgart manufacturer opt to return to F1 however, it is thought that this would be as an engine supplier as opposed to entering as a fully fledged constructor. No doubt some are wondering whether McLaren might be interested is renewing what was a very successful 'marriage'.
